Article The Titans have added LB Owen Pappoe, DB Melvin Smith, DT Nazir Stackhouse, OT James Hudson III and S Terrell Burgess. The Titans have waived WR Xavier Restrepo, OT Austin Deculus, S Jerrick Reed II, CB Erick Hallett II and LB Mohamoud Diabate.
